"This morning, it was crazy!" said Paterson resident Jermain Harris.
Residents tell Eyewitness News it was a couple who lost their life - Juan Rodriguez says he knows the woman who died.
"It is sad because she was a good person, she didn't deserve anything like this," says Rodriguez.
At this point, fire officials have not identified the couple, but believe they know who they are. They haven't said how the fire started, but the Fire Marshal is investigating.
A source on the scene tells Eyewitness News that a gas can was found near the home. Neighbors also believe a third person lived in the home as well.
"I'm surprised the whole block didn't catch on fire," says Harris.
The whole block catching on fire was certainly a possibility judging the damage to the house next door. Victor Manuel was woken up by emergency crews banging on the door after the fire reached his home.
"He knocked the door, he told me something was burning - he's like 'fire, fire!'" Manuel says.
Manuel had to evacuate his home along with the other people living in the house, because the structure is now unstable.
"It surprised me, I'm still like kind of astonished, I can't really believe it," Manuel adds.
A squad car patrolled the home late Sunday night continuing to search for answers.
